One of the more unique selling points of KeyLab Essential 88 is the new keybed, which “strikes the perfect balance between fast synth action and a traditional weighted piano feel”, according to Arturia. This will allow you to have a deeper interaction with your favourite DAW and software instruments, potentially opening more creative opportunities. Those familiar with the KeyLab Essential range will be well accustomed to the 16 performance pad, 9 fader and rotary knob layout, which can be mapped using the Arturia MIDI software.
